Event Overview: A True Test of Endurance

The Weston Hospicecare LEL Cycle Challenge is part of the renowned London–Edinburgh–London (LEL) series, a gruelling 1,540 km ride to be completed in under 125 hours with 21 checkpoints along the route. Riders will tackle rolling hills, night‑time stretches, and the scenic beauty of Britain’s landscapes—all to raise vital funds for Weston Hospicecare’s expert end‑of‑life support, provided free of charge to families facing life‑limiting illnesses.

Key details:

  • Distance: 1,540 km (London → Edinburgh → London)
  • Time Limit: 125 hours maximum
  • Checkpoints: 21 check-points
  • Date: 3 – 8 August 2025

Meet the Riders: Jason Smith & Joss Ridley

Jason Smith brings decades of endurance in numerous adventures and cycling experience (Top 100 British Adventurers) and a personal connection to Weston Hospicecare, having organised multiple charity rides, climbs to summits and events in memory of loved ones. Joss Ridley, known in the endurance community as “Orange Socks,” is famed for his strategic pacing and unwavering resilience in ultra‑distance events, including Trans Continental Race across Europe where he and Jason first met. Impact on Weston Hospicecare

Weston Hospicecare relies on less than 15% government funding, meaning every pound raised through the LEL Cycle Challenge directly underwrites vital services:

  • 24/7 clinical advice and home‑care visits
  • Pain management and symptom control
  • Emotional and spiritual support for patients and families
